Don’t Clean Your Toilet with This Social Media Hack, Warns Plumber

Social media is a treasure trove of tips and tricks for household cleaning, but not all of them are safe or effective. One particular toilet cleaning hack that has gained traction online is raising eyebrows among professional plumbers. Here’s what you need to know about this risky cleaning method and safer alternatives to keep your toilet spotless.

The Social Media Cleaning Hack: What Is It?

Recently, social media users have been sharing a video that claims a simple combination of household products can transform your dirty toilet into a sparkling throne. This hack typically involves:

  • Using soda (like cola) as a cleaning agent
  • Pouring vinegar for its disinfecting properties
  • Adding baking soda to scrub away stains

Proponents of this method tout its effectiveness, but many plumbers are warning against trying it out.

Why Plumbers Are Concerned

While the idea of using common kitchen products to clean your toilet might seem appealing, plumbers have serious concerns about this hack. Here are some of the reasons why:

1. Chemical Reactions

The combination of certain household products can lead to unpredictable chemical reactions. Mixing vinegar and baking soda creates carbon dioxide gas, which can cause overflowing or a nasty mess in your toilet bowl.

2. Potential Damage to Plumbing

Sodas and other acidic liquids may cause corrosion and damage to plumbing pipes over time, leading to costly repairs and clogs.

3. Ineffectiveness

Despite claims, many of these hacks simply don’t work as effectively as traditional toilet cleaners. They may address surface stains, but they often fail to eliminate bacteria and other harmful germs.

Safe & Effective Alternatives for Toilet Cleaning

If you’re concerned about keeping your toilet clean without resorting to risky social media hacks, consider these proven methods:

  • Commercial Toilet Cleaners: Look for products specifically designed for toilets that effectively kill germs and break down stains.
  • Baking Soda and Vinegar: While mixing them in the toilet can be problematic, using them separately can still provide cleaning power. Sprinkle baking soda in the bowl, let it sit, then follow with vinegar for a powerful clean.
  • Essential Oils: Adding a few drops of tea tree oil or lavender oil can help disinfect and leave a pleasant scent.
  • Professional Help: For tough stains or persistent odors, consider hiring a plumbing professional who has access to industrial cleaning agents and tools.

Best Practices for Toilet Maintenance

Keeping your toilet clean doesn’t have to be a daunting task. Here are some best practices for regular maintenance:

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ean your toilet at least once a week to prevent the buildup of grime and bacteria.
  • Avoid harsh chemicals: Steer clear of products that contain bleach, which can damage the ceramic and plumbing.
  • Use a Toilet Brush: Invest in a good-quality toilet brush to effectively scrub the bowl without scratching the surface.
  • Leave the Lid Down: This simple trick can prevent dust and debris from settling in your toilet bowl.
